A formal, nonbinding resolution commends David F. Byers, Jr. for outstanding service to education in Alabama.
What This Bill DoesThis enrolled Senate Joint Resolution recognizes and honors David F. Byers, Jr. for his long service to education, including his tenure on the State Board of Education since 1995 representing District 6. It outlines his educational background and professional work, and notes his civic leadership and efforts to improve public education. The resolution expresses highest tribute and appreciation and offers best wishes for his future endeavors.

- Provides background on his education: BA from the University of Alabama at Birmingham; JD cum laude from Cumberland School of Law at Samford University; LLM in Taxation from New York University.
- Describes his professional and civic roles: Managing Director of Capital Strategies Group, LLC; former partner at Wallace, Jordan, Ratliff, and Brandt; member of the American Bar Association, Alabama Bar Association, and Community Foundation of Greater Birmingham committees; past Chairman of The King's Ranch; Leadership Alabama graduate; Education Leaders Council member; Briarwood Presbyterian Church session member.
